Cost-Effectiveness: Comparing the Monetary Elements of Dental Implants and Dentures



If you're considering dental implants or dentures, you might be asking yourself which option is a lot more cost-efficient. When it involves set you back, it is essential to think about both the first financial investment and the lasting expenses.

Oral implants have a tendency to have a greater in advance expense compared to dentures. This is since the procedure of dental implant positioning includes surgical procedure and making use of top notch materials. Nonetheless, it deserves keeping in mind that oral implants are developed to be a long-lasting solution. They're a lot more long lasting and can last a life time with proper treatment, decreasing the need for regular substitutes or repairs.

On the other hand, dentures may have a lower first price, but they may call for changes, relining, or perhaps replacement over time, which can add up in terms of continuous costs.

Inevitably, the cost-effectiveness of oral implants versus dentures depends on your specific needs and preferences, along with your long-lasting dental health objectives.

Longevity: Understanding the Durability and Life Expectancy of Dental Implants and Dentures



Think about the long life and life expectancy of oral implants and dentures when making a decision which option is right for you. Both oral implants and dentures have their own resilience and life-span, and it's important to recognize these variables prior to deciding.

Below are 4 key points to take into consideration:

1. Implants: Oral implants are designed to be a permanent solution for missing teeth. With appropriate care and maintenance, they can last a lifetime. This is since implants are surgically positioned in the jawbone, supplying a secure foundation for fabricated teeth.

2. Dentures: Dentures, on the other hand, are removable home appliances that replace missing teeth. While they can be a cost-efficient option, they usually have a shorter life expectancy contrasted to implants. Dentures might require to be changed every 5-7 years because of wear and tear.

3. Maintenance: Dental implants require routine cleaning, flossing, and dental exams, similar to all-natural teeth. Dentures need day-to-day cleansing and saturating to stop germs buildup.

4. Bone Wellness: Dental implants promote the jawbone, protecting against bone loss and preserving facial framework. Dentures, nevertheless, do not give the same degree of excitement, which can bring about bone loss with time.

Understanding the sturdiness and lifespan of oral implants and dentures is crucial in making an educated choice. Speak with your dental expert to determine which option is best matched for your details demands and conditions.
